=Frapping.=--The drawing together the several returns of a lashing
so as to tauten it. The rope used for frapping is generally the
running-end of the lashing itself; after having frapped, the end of the
rope is made fast by two half-hitches, one around all the returns, the
other on half only.
BRIDGES.
=Weight.=--Infantry in column of fours when crowded is allowed per
lineal foot 560 pounds.
Cavalry under same conditions is allowed 700 pounds.
Field-artillery in column of sections weighs 400 pounds per lineal
foot, so that a bridge built for infantry will carry it.
In calculating the strength of parts of bridges the live load must be
doubled to bring it to dead load if weight is to be applied suddenly.
Formula for weight that may be borne safely by a beam supported at both
ends and loaded in the centre:
_W_ = _b__d²__S_/_l_,
_W_ being the weight in pounds, _l_ the distance between the points of
support, _d_ the depth, and _b_ the breadth, all expressed in inches.
_S_ is a coefficient whose value for different kinds of wood is given
in the following table:
Ash 2000
Yellow Pine 1100
Beech 1700
Larch 1300
Birch 1900
Oak 1600
=Strength of Round Timber.=--The strength of a circular pole is six
tenths that of a square beam whose side is equal to the mean diameter
of the pole; so that the equation becomes _W_ = 6_d__S_/10_l_, in which
_d_ is the mean diameter.
The bridge must be capable of sustaining the weight when crowded;
and while the load for infantry is usually distributed, the greatest
strain is brought on the balks, or road-bearers, when the gun-wheels
are at the centre of the bay; and a balk will only bear half the load
concentrated at its centre that it will bear when distributed.
=Roadway and Approaches.=-The roadway may be of planks 1½ to 2 inches
for ordinary traffic, or of poles, fascines, hurdles, etc. Litter or
earth should be scattered over it to deaden the rattle of planks,
which is apt to frighten the horses, and preserve the roadway. If
heavy loads are to be hauled, planks should be laid longitudinally
to form wheel-tracks. Eight feet in the clear will suffice for width
of roadway, but nine feet is to be preferred. A hand-rail should be
provided, especially if horses are to pass, and ribbands on either
side. At least five balks (road-bearers) should be used on a bridge
nine feet wide. The bays generally run from ten to fifteen feet.
A rise in the centre of the bridge, called the camber, is allowed for
the subsequent settling. This allowance is usually one thirtieth of the
bay. The approaches are very important; the exit must be fully as good
as the entrance, to avoid crowding. If not, care must be taken not to
admit troops at the entrance faster than they can pass off. Ramps at
either end steeper than one on ten are inconvenient.
